Context
This hadith discusses the distance of Al-'Awali from Medina, as narrated by Al-Zuhri. It reflects the geographical context of the time and provides insight into the locations significant to the early Muslim community. The mention of distances also indicates the importance of understanding one's surroundings in relation to religious practices.

About Sunan Abu Dawud
This hadith is #405 from Sunan Abu Dawud, in the Book of Prayer (Kitab Al-Salat). It is graded Sahih Maqtu' and narrated by Al-Zuhri said:.
